Ph.D.  Architecture Syllabus

Course Title Description
Research Methodologies Exploration of qualitative and quantitative research methods, literature review techniques, and data analysis to support doctoral research in architecture.
Advanced Architectural Theory Critical examination of contemporary and historical architectural theories, including semiotics, phenomenology, post-structuralism, and critical regionalism.
Design Innovation Investigation of innovative design processes, technologies, and materials to address complex architectural challenges and promote sustainability and resilience.
Urban Planning and Design Study of urban theory, policy, and design strategies to create livable, sustainable, and inclusive urban environments through interdisciplinary approaches.
Environmental Sustainability Examination of sustainable building practices, renewable energy systems, green infrastructure, and ecological design principles to mitigate climate change impacts in architectural projects.
Digital Fabrication Application of digital tools, parametric modeling, and fabrication techniques to explore design possibilities and streamline construction processes in contemporary architectural practice.
Historic Preservation Preservation ethics, documentation, and conservation methodologies for historic structures, landscapes, and cultural heritage sites, emphasizing adaptive reuse and community engagement.

Top 10 Government Ph.D. Architecture Colleges in India with Fee Structure

Tabulated below is the collection of the Top 10 Government Ph.D. Architecture Colleges in India with Fee Structure, including their key features.

Name of the institute Location Fees
NIT Trichy Tiruchirappalli, Tamil Nadu INR 168,250
College of Engineering Thiruvananthapuram, Kerala INR 200,000
Veer Narmad South Gujarat University Surat, Gujarat INR 80,000
Thiagarajar College of Engineering Madurai, Tamil Nadu INR 82,000
School of Planning and Architecture Vijayawada, Andhra Pradesh INR 87,000
Madhav Institute of Technology and Science Gwalior, Madhya Pradesh INR 133,120
Faculty of Architecture, Dr. A. P. J. Abdul Kalam Technical University Lucknow, Uttar Pradesh INR 54,200
University VOC College of Engineering, Anna University Thoothukudi, Tamil Nadu INR 43,810
Jawaharlal Nehru Architecture and Fine Arts University Hyderabad, Telangana INR 70,000
NIT Patna Patna, Bihar INR 165,700
